Starbucks' Latest Offering: The 'Soupuccino'!
Starbucks Coffee Japan is set to delight customers this winter with an exciting new beverage: the 'Truffle Soupuccino.' Starting November 14, 2025, this innovative twist on a classic cappuccino takes our love for coffee into the world of soup—perfect for warming up during the chilly months ahead.
A New Kind of Comfort Food
The 'Soupuccino' is the first of its kind at Starbucks, crafted carefully by baristas using finely steamed foam milk, reminiscent of the beloved cappuccino. This soup delivers an unexpectedly smooth and light texture that is both comforting and refreshing. Whether you’re feeling a bit peckish, need a little comfort, or simply want to start your day right, the 'Soupuccino' is designed to elevate your Starbucks experience.
The 'Truffle Soupuccino' boasts a rich blend of flavors. It features the fragrant essence of black truffles, alongside the earthy notes of mushrooms and porcini. Enhanced by crispy bacon and vegetable broth, this creamy delight is layered with depth and richness, ensuring each sip warms not just the body but also the soul. The delicate balance of these flavors means even a short size offers ample satisfaction, making it perfect for a light meal or snack.
Customization is a key element at Starbucks, and the 'Soupuccino' is no exception. You can choose your milk: soy milk imparts a gentle sweetness, while oat or almond milks add a nutty finish, allowing you to tailor your soup experience to your taste.
Pricing and Availability
- - Product Name: Truffle Soupuccino
- - Price: 491 yen for takeout, 500 yen for in-store consumption (tax included).
- - Sales Period: Starts November 14, 2025
- - Available Locations: Nationwide at Starbucks stores (excluding some).
Introducing the 'Good Start Morning'
On the same day, Starbucks will also launch its renewed morning service, “Good Start Morning.” This new initiative invites coffee lovers to enjoy a selected beverage and food together at a discounted price. Unlike the previous 'Size-Up Morning,' this service offers a 40 yen discount when purchasing an eligible drink along with an eligible food item from the morning menu.
This new morning offering features the delightful 'Truffle Soupuccino' along with hearty options like the 'Bacon, Egg, and Cheese Bagel Sandwich,' perfect for jumpstarting your day with warmth and satisfaction.
'Good Start Morning' Details
- - Discount: 40 yen off for in-store prices, 39 yen off for takeout.
- - Eligible Items:
-
Beverages: 'Truffle Soupuccino,' 'Brewed Coffee,' 'Café Misto,' and various lattes.
-
Food: 'Bacon, Egg and Cheese Bagel Sandwich,' 'Strawberry & Cranberry Bagel Sandwich,' 'Sausage Pastry,' and 'Sugar Donut.'
- - Service Period: November 14, 2025 – December 25, 2025 (subject to extensions).
- - Service Hours: OPEN to 11:00 AM.

About Starbucks Coffee Japan
Starbucks Coffee Japan opened its first store in Ginza, Tokyo, in 1996. Currently, Starbucks operates over 37,000 stores worldwide across 80 markets and holds a strong presence in Japan with 2,041 stores as of June 2025. With around 60,000 partners (employees) providing quality coffee and fostering connections, Starbucks continues to be a place where people come together for a heartwarming experience. The newly opened 'Starbucks Reserve® Roastery Tokyo' in February 2019 marked its fifth global location, showcasing quality and variety for coffee enthusiasts.
